TL;DR Summary

Researchers found that gut-derived exosomes carry age-related signals; older exosomes induced insulin resistance, inflammation, and gut barrier damage when transferred to young mice, while exosomes from young mice reversed several aging-related changes in older mice, suggesting gut particles actively help spread aging and could offer targets to treat age-associated diseases.
